Soft Dinner Rolls: Tender, Fluffy & Easy Recipe — perfect for breakfast, brunch, or meal prep. Makes 12 pillow-soft pull-apart rolls in 103 minutes with 8 simple pantry ingredients.
Ingredients
Scale
- 500 g (4 cups) all-purpose flour
- 7 g (1 packet / 2 1/4 tsp) instant yeast
- 25 g (2 tbsp) granulated sugar
- 9 g (1 1/2 tsp Diamond Crystal / 1 tsp Morton’s salt
- 240 ml (1 cup) whole milk, warmed
- 60 g (4 tbsp) unsalted butter, melted and cooled
- 1 large egg (50 g), room temperature
- 15 g (1 tbsp) additional melted butter (optional, for brushing after baking)
Instructions
- Warm the milk and mix the wet ingredients by whisking the warm milk, melted butter, egg, and sugar in a small bowl.
- Combine dry ingredients in a large bowl by whisking flour, yeast, and salt together.
- Pour the wet mixture into the dry ingredients and stir with a wooden spoon until a shaggy dough forms.
- Knead the dough by hand on a lightly floured surface for 6–8 minutes or use a stand mixer for 4–5 minutes until smooth.
- Place the dough in an oiled bowl, cover, and let rise in a warm spot until doubled, about 45–60 minutes.
- Turn the dough onto a floured surface and divide into 12 equal pieces, shaping each into a tight ball.
- Arrange the rolls in a greased pan and let proof until puffy, about 30–45 minutes.
- Bake in a preheated oven at 190°C (375°F) for 15–18 minutes until golden brown.
- Remove from oven and brush with melted butter for a soft crust. Let cool for 10 minutes before serving.
Notes
- Fridge Storage: Place completely cooled rolls in an airtight container or zip-top bag with as much air removed as possible. Store on a middle refrigerator shelf at or below 40 °F for up to 5 days. Adding a small piece of parchment between layers prevents sticking and moisture buildup.
- Freezer Storage: Wrap each cooled roll individually in plastic wrap, then place them inside a freezer-safe zip-top bag. Label with the date and freeze for up to 3 months. Flash-freezing on a sheet pan for 1 hour first prevents rolls from clumping together in the bag.
- Oven Reheat: Preheat your oven to 350 °F (175 °C). Wrap rolls loosely in aluminum foil to prevent over-browning and place on the center rack. Heat for 8–10 minutes until warm throughout. For frozen rolls, increase time to 15 minutes without thawing first.
- Microwave Reheat: Wrap a single roll in a damp paper towel and microwave on medium power for 20–25 seconds. The damp towel reintroduces steam, keeping the crumb soft rather than rubbery. Eat immediately—microwaved bread toughens as it cools back down.
- Air Fryer Reheat: Set your air fryer to 300 °F (150 °C). Place rolls in a single layer in the basket—no oil needed. Heat for 3–4 minutes until the exterior is lightly crisp and the interior is warm. This method restores a fresh-baked texture that the microwave cannot match.
